Orangeville is a village located in Stephenson County, in the state of Illinois (IL), United States. Nestled in the East North Central division of the Midwest region, it covers an area of 0.6 square miles (2.0 km²) and sits at an elevation of 830 ft. With a population of approximately 751 residents, Orangeville offers a peaceful, rural atmosphere.

The town's population is composed of about 50.33% males and 49.67% females, and it has a population density of 173.44 people per square mile (453.07/km²). Orangeville lies at a latitude of 42.47 and a longitude of -89.65, operating in the UTC-6.

Locals reflect a blend of American ancestry, with roots primarily in United States (5.1%), followed by English (5.9%), German (55.4%), and Scotch-Irish (0%) heritage. The town is identified by the ZIP code 61060.
